At around 3:20 pm today (10/26) I was rear ended and pushed into the vehicle ahead of me.
I was heading in the left lane down the street, traffic was rather busy ahead of me, and suddenly the car in front of me was stopped. I slammed on my brakes and came to a complete stop, all while at the same time looking in my rearview mirror and knowing the '77 Chevy Silverado behind me had no chance of stopping in time. So I braced for impact. As soon as he slammed into the back of me my eyes closed, and when I re-opened them I noticed I was halfway on the median and the car that was ahead of me, a Chevy Monte Carlo, was now on my right and that his left rear taillight was busted out. I sat there for a second, swore my choice word, and stepped out of the vehicle to walk around to the back. Not pretty. The bumper is smashed, not as badly as I thought it'd be, but there's a hole punctured in it. The trunk was pushed up and forward rather violently. Then I walked around to the right side and was greeted by a dented front right wheel fender and scrapes and dents all along the entire right side of the vehicle. Immediately we all began to exchange information. The guy who hit me is one of my good friends, and he has complete coverage. The guy ahead of me has liability. At that moment a police car rolled up. He stepped out and asked if we'd called the police yet; we explained we were in the process of exchanging info and would be doing that ASAP. Then he left... Because traffic was so horribly congested and we were a main cause of it, we moved our vehicles into the Wells Fargo parking lot. (Luckily my car was still driveable). The entrance was exactly next to where the accident happened. I called the police and reported what had happened. 10-15 minutes later an officer showed up, took all of our info and had us fill out accident reports. He gave us all a report number, and told me and the guy in front of me that we were free to go. The driver of the truck was issued a ticket for following too closely and stayed behind with the cop.
